- The distance between Choma, Zambia and Ishigakijima, Japan is approximately 11,467 km or 7,126 mi.
- To reach Choma in this distance one would set out from Ishigakijima bearing 257.2°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Choma bearing 248.2° or WSW .
- Choma has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Ishigakijima has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The average annual temperature is 4.7 °C (8.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.4 °C (4.3°F) less in Choma.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1264 mm (49.8 in) less which is equivalent to 1264 l/m² (31.02 US gal/ft²) or 12,640,000 l/ha (1,351,300 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.4° higher in Choma than in Ishigakijima.
- Relative humidity levels are 17.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.6°C (15.5°F) lower.
